Learn more about A Guarda

Climb to the ancient Celtic ruins of Castro de Santa Trega for panoramic views of where the Miño River meets the Atlantic. Seafood lovers shouldn't miss the harbour restaurants serving fresh octopus and shellfish caught by A Guarda's fishing fleet.

Best time to go to A Guarda

The best time to visit A Guarda can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in A Guarda falls in August, when vis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is sunny with no rain. The coolest average temperature in A Guarda falls in January,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January50.7°F (10.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ately LowSlightly Low
February51.1°F (10.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ately LowSlightly Low
March53.4°F (11.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ately LowSlightly Low
April56.1°F (13.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
May60.4°F (15.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June64.2°F (17.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
July67.6°F (19.8°C)No RainSunnyModerately HighSlightly High
August68.0°F (20.0°C)No RainSunnyModerately HighSlightly High
September66.4°F (19.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ighAverage
October62.4°F (16.9°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
November55.9°F (13.3°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
December52.7°F (11.5°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to A Guarda

Flying into A Guarda is convenient with three major airports nearby. Porto (OPO-Dr. Francisco de Sa Carneiro) is 75.6km away, with hotels like Porto Palácio Hotel by The Editory and Hilton Porto Gaia offering various shuttle services. Santiago-Rosalía de Castro Airport (SCQ) is 115.9km distant, with options such as Parador de Santiago de Compostela providing nearby access. The closest airport is Vigo (VGO-Peinador), located just 40.2km away, where hotels like Gran Hotel Nagari Boutique & Spa offer 24-hour shuttle services. What is the best area to stay in A Guarda?
The best area to stay in A Guarda is generally around the town centre and along the waterfront, particularly near the fishing port.

This central area is the heart of A Guarda, offering easy access to the main attractions. You'll find a good selection of shops, restaurants, and cafes along the main streets like Avenida de Portugal and Rúa Galicia. The fishing port itself is a working area but also a pleasant spot for a stroll, with views of the boats and the sea. The town's promenade stretches along the coast, superb for evening walks.

Couples often find this area ideal for a relaxing getaway. Staying centrally means you're close to eateries serving fresh seafood and can easily access the scenic walks along the coast. The convenience of having everything within a short walk makes for a stress-free holiday.

For those looking to combine relaxation with cultural exploration, staying near the base of Monte Santa Trega is also a good option. While slightly outside the immediate town centre, it offers direct access to the hiking trails leading up to the Celtic settlement and panoramic viewpoints.
